Over the last forty years there has been a movement amongst artists to challenge how we wear, think of and value jewellery. By replacing gold, platinum and diamonds with materials of lower monetary value, like wood, aluminium and paper, the aim has been to create jewellery that is ‘precious’ due to the design and craftsmanship. Despite this change in approach and perception very few leading jewellers create work in glass.Date
